Job Overview:


The Phlebotomist will obtain and process lab samples from patients per provider's requests while following protocols required by CLIA, CLSI, AAAHC, OSHA, and other JVCHC, state, or Federal regulations.


Duties:

  • Performs phlebotomy skillfully utilizing proper laboratory procedures as outlined by CLSI with minimal discomfort to the patient.
  • Obtains and collects high quality specimens that are appropriate for the ordered laboratory tests.
  • Disinfects laboratory surfaces with daily cleaning.
  • Verifies and records identity of patient using 2 patient identifiers.
  • Effectively interacts with patient to minimize the apprehension of the phlebotomy procedure.
  • Correctly labels, processes and properly stores blood and body fluid specimens according to the specimen requirements.
  • Conducts all waived in-house lab tests efficiently as ordered by prodders, and correctly documents.
  • Maintains a strict level of patient confidentiality.
  • Assists with orientation of laboratory procedures for students and/or new laboratory employees.
  • All other duties as assigned.
